BHealthy University is the educational and resource hub within BHealthy For Life platform designed to support mental health, behavioral wellness, addiction recovery, and professional development. It provides self-guided learning, psychoeducation, recovery resources, practitioner tools, and wellness content for both individuals and behavioral health professionals.

BHealthy University was created as a cost-free behavioral health education platform intended to make mental health and recovery resources more accessible while helping individuals and professionals stay informed, organized, and connected in their wellness journey.

Meditation is a scientifically supported practice that trains the mind to improve focus, emotional balance, and overall well-being. Research shows that regular meditation can reduce stress, calm the nervous system, enhance attention, improve sleep, and strengthen the brain's ability to regulate emotions through neuroplasticity—the brain's natural capacity to adapt and grow. Like physical exercise strengthens the body, meditation strengthens the mind, helping individuals build greater resilience, clarity, and inner calm over time.

Breathwork is a research-supported practice that uses intentional breathing techniques to influence the nervous system, reduce stress, and improve mental and physical well-being. Scientific studies show that controlled breathing can help regulate heart rate, lower cortisol levels, increase oxygen efficiency, and activate the body's natural relaxation response. Regular breathwork has been associated with reduced anxiety, improved focus, enhanced emotional regulation, and greater resilience, making it a powerful tool for supporting overall health and wellness.
Note: Some intensive breathwork techniques, such as Holotropic Breathwork and Conscious Connected Breathing, can evoke strong physical and emotional responses. They are best practiced with a trained facilitator and may not be appropriate for people with certain medical conditions, including cardiovascular disease, uncontrolled high blood pressure, epilepsy, or pregnancy.

Journaling is a simple yet powerful tool for healing. Research shows that putting thoughts and emotions into words helps calm the brain's stress response, improve emotional regulation, and strengthen the brain's ability to process difficult experiences. By creating space for self-reflection, journaling promotes clarity, resilience, and lasting emotional healing.

Sound Therapy uses soothing tones, vibrations, and frequencies from instruments such as singing bowls, tuning forks, gongs, chimes, or calming music to promote relaxation and support emotional well-being. While listening to calming sounds can help reduce stress, encourage mindfulness, and activate the body's relaxation response, current research does not support claims that specific frequencies directly heal the body or treat medical conditions. As part of a holistic wellness approach, sound therapy can create a peaceful environment that helps quiet the mind, regulate the nervous system, and enhance overall feelings of balance and calm.
